Quelle. Daten aus dem Jahr 2022 wurden im Jahr 2024 veröffentlicht. Für Länder ohne Daten im Jahr 2022 werden die neuesten verfügbaren Daten verwendet. Berücksichtigt werden nur Slums und informelle Siedlungen in städtischen Gebieten (u. a. in der Quelle). Unzureichender Wohnraum (b. in der Quelle) ist nicht enthalten.

    Die Zahlen basieren auf vier Haushalten, denen die Unterkunft entzogen wurde von UN-Habitat als Indikatoren für Informalität definiert: Mangel an Zugang zu verbesserter Wasserversorgung, Mangel an Zugang zu verbesserter Sanitärversorgung, Mangel an ausreichender Wohnfläche und Qualität/Haltbarkeit der Struktur.
